Located in Loughrigg near Ambleside and the Langdale Valleys Ellers Close is a great place to stay in the heart of the Lake District. Being well equipped, comfortable and spacious this property offers everything you need for a fantastic self catering holiday.
Ellers Close is a much loved family home, and a great place for you to create holiday memories with friends and family. This character-ful, stone built house provides spacious accommodation for up to 4 people. The comfortable accommodation and fantastic location makes this the ideal property for self catering holidays in the Lake District. Explore the walks, lakes and views directly from the doorstep of Ellers Close, or jump in the car for a short drive to Ambleside, Grasmere or Hawkshead for a choice of places to eat, drink and explore the culture of the Lake District.
Size : Sleeps 4, 3 bedroomsNearest amenities: 0.8 miles to Skelwith Bridge and Chesters, 2 miles to Co-op at Chapel StileShort breaks: Available at this property
Pets: 2 Pets allowed at an additional cost
Smoking: No smoking at this propertyRooms: 1 double bedroom with king size beds, 2 single rooms, family bathroom, lounge, dining room, kitchen.Beds: 1 king-size bed, 2 single bedsLuxuries: Large, enclosed gardenGeneral: TV
Utilities: Ceramic hob, electric oven, microwave, fridge and freezer sectionStandard: Kettle, toaster, ironOther: Bed linen and towels provided, WiFi. Parking: Off road, private driveway parking space for 2 cars

Mrs Francis
What a delightful cottagel Very homely atmosphere with beautiful local pictures amidst more personal ones dotted around. Tasteful carpets at the same time as being sensible for a holiday cottage! Clearly people have loved coming on holiday here for years and the owners have had many returning guests - unsurprisingly. Very spacious house. Sheets and bedding exceedingly comfortable. Warm! Great to have a nice shower and bath with hot water never running out! The location could not have been better with a most beautiful (and secure) garden with "rooms", a variety of plants and trees and birds. Great to have a secure place for our dog who loved it. Small little stream in garden so you can hear the gentle burbling of the brook. Set just in front of Loughrigg Fell with with the bonus of a 5 minute walk to the Tarn where you can swim in the clear clean water; only a 10 minute drive to Ambleside - a peaceful iddylic setting which made for a memorable holiday. A special thing too to gaze at the stars so clearly at night without any light pollution to blot their view. We'd definitely come again but realise we'd have to book very early so as not to be disappointed. Thank you!
